Hike and bike trails

Hike and bike trails help communities meet shared value goals by creating a space to stay connected, be active, and embrace nature. Active trails shape the liveability and mobility for long-term community attractiveness.

With the pace of urbanization, pre-emptive planning for further development of hike and bike trails should become a priority during municipal, and county planning. This may include considerations for new planning development, revitalization of existing parks, or conversion of brownfield or abandoned properties into green spaces.

Environmental considerations

Environmental impacts should always be considered as part of the project design. Sustainable design will consider beneficial impacts to water quality and general ecology. Example elements may include wetland plantings, pocket prairies, and permeable pavers. Planting selections will also vary based on plants native to the area and general environmental conditions.

Other environmental and sustainability factors to include during planning are:

  • Resiliency in Floodways and Floodplains
  • Erosion control
  • Sustainable/nature-based solutions

Considerations for trail design

Slopes, grades, and existing land conditions all play a role in the applied geometry used to design a trail plan. Safety elements are another critical element to factor in the design to ensure usability and trail adoption.

Factors for planning

Geometry (horizontal and vertical)

  • Trail intersections
  • Street intersections or crossings
  • On-street pavement conditions
  • Drainage
  • Trail edge protection
  • AASHTO Guide for the Development of Bicycle Facilities
  • ADA requirements
  • Retaining wall types/drainage
  • Maintenance access

Safety considerations

  • Lighting
  • Callbox/blue phone
  • Striping/signing
  • Railing
  • On-street painted/delineated/separated
  • Trail tie-ins
  • Vehicle prohibition
  • Crossings signals
  • Horizontal clearance from vertical obstructions
